Williams Tuesday: Personna Shavette Voskhod TGN Silvertip Badger Neutrogena Post Balm Old Spice Yeah yeah yeah. I know you have to lather Williams with boar. But if I'm gonna keep touting my TGN silvertip and saying "it's by far my favorite brush," blablabla "it can do anything," and so on and so forth, well then it's gotta pass the Williams test doesn't it? So...did it pass? See bottom pic. I soaked the soap and brush during my shower, then came out and basically left the brush full of water and loaded it up very heavily. It started foaming up immediately, but because the brush was so loaded it was literally swimming in Williams and so took a while to get it to thicken up. Eventually it did though, and I wound up having plenty of lather for a 5 pass shave with some left over. It did dry out fairly quickly once on my face so I had to reapply occasionally, but other than that it was completely decent. Protection and glide was ok, nothing special. I'll definitely use the omega boar next time and see how it compares. I did have to change blades out 3 passes in because I was having a really hard time getting close, and that made an immediate difference. I think in a shavette even a Voskhod only lasts two measly shaves. Fatboy with the same set at 4 for cleanup, and a dab of the Old Spice because for some reason I love it on rainy days.
